Youngest players to reach 50 goal involvements in Premier League

Despite the action being end to end in the Premier League, scoring goals have always been a difficult task. With most of the teams have rock-solid defences, it would often take a moment of magic to break down the opponents’ resilience. But there are some players who have been able to be productive in the final third, particularly from a young age. Let us take a look at the youngest players to reach 50 goal involvements in Premier League.

Legendary former Liverpool striker Michael Owen tops this list. He is the youngest player in Premier League history to reach 50 goal contributions. Owen had achieved this landmark when he was 19 years and 68 days old, according to Opta Analyst. The former English international had an explosive start to life at the top level, as he kept scoring for fun. Defenders struggled to stop him, as Owen went from strength to strength, creating new records along the way.

Bukayo Saka is the latest addition to this list

Wayne Rooney is the second fastest youngster in Premier League history to reach 50 goal involvements. Rooney, who played for Everton and Manchester United, manged this feat at 20 years and 54 days. Among the other players, the latest addition to this list is Arsenal youngster Bukayo Saka. The right winger is excellent at cutting inside or going outside of the defender. He has been consistently producing the goods for the Gunners in recent past. Find out below to see who are the other players to have made it into this list:

SL NoNameAge
1Michael Owen19 years 68 days
2Wayne Rooney20 years 54 days
3Robbie Fowler20 years 167 days
4Cesc Fabregas20 years 337 days
5Chris Sutton21 years 170 days
6Bukayo Saka21 years 177 days
